Causative factors of Chronic Kidney Diseases of Uncertain Aetiology (CKDu)

• Prevalent in certain parts of the dry zone • Evidence shows;

– high level of Arsenic, Cadmium in humans in these areas – Low levels of Selenium in humans (Malnutrition) – High levels of Calcium and fluoride in the water – Presence of Agrochemicals residues in humans – Dehydration due to inadequate drinking of water & heat – Alcohol and tobacco consumption – Excessive and indiscriminate use of agrochemicals

• Need further research while primary and secondary preventive measures are being taken

Financial Assistance

Recommendation of MoH • To be given to those in 21 high risk divisional

secretariat areas in 9 districts • 3000/= for CKDu stage III • 5000/= for those undergoing dialysis
